Willie Cole: Artist turns ‘waste into beauty’ to highlight water issues

Melisa Rose Cooper , NJ Spotlight News, March 9, 2023

 

World-renowned artist and Newark native Willie Cole recently unveiled two of his larger-than-life sculptures that focus on water, specifically Newark’s issues with contaminated water. Cole used unlikely material in the artwork — empty water bottles.

 

“I’m turning waste into beauty, but in general waste is hiding the beauty,” Cole said. “When the ground is covered with garbage, you can’t see the grass or the flowers. And these bottles are everywhere.”

 

Two chandeliers created by Cole, ‘The Spirit Catcher” and “Lumen-less Lantern,” are on display at Express Newark, Rutgers University, where Cole is the current artist-in-residence.
